Subject: Key rotation — Stagemap renderer

For review: we rotated the credential the Gildercrest seat-map renderer uses to fetch venue layouts from the internal Hallplan service. Old key revoked as of this morning; no overlap window. Renderer access remains read-only and scoped to published layouts. Audit logs for the rotation are attached to the change record. The replacement key for the Hallplan service follows below.

service key, fawip-bajef: kto11_Qt5wZK9vdNC

## Further reading

Undo and redo in Marlowe Draw are implemented as a command log, not state snapshots. Plugins that mutate the canvas must register inverse commands, or user undo will silently skip your changes. Please read the command-log contract carefully before shipping, including the section on batched operations and transaction boundaries. The full specification and worked examples are maintained on the internal page below.

wiki page, bagaf-fawip: https://harbor.tolvaqsys.local/pages/repo/pages/secrets/eac969ffc71f356b

- [ ] Step 7: Archive cold storage buckets (Glacierline tier). Confirm both ceremony witnesses are present, verify bucket manifests match the Oxbow ledger, then seal the archive key shares. Plugin authors may observe but not handle shares. Once sealed, the archive index itself is encrypted and can only be reopened with the passphrase below.

vault phrase of badup-hahig = tamael-aldael-kelmir-istael-fenok-istwyn-tamius-jorath-oliion

New starter — day one checklist, Halverton facilities desk.

- [ ] Archive room orientation (basement, level B2). Escort the starter down; lights are on a timer by the stairwell. Show the retrieval log, the rolling shelves, and the no-food rule. Boxes go back where they came from — shelf labels, not memory. Fire door stays shut. Exit via the main stairs only. The archive room keypad is to the left of the door; they'll need the code below.

door code, kawip-bagap: bdg-HQEWH-4